UPDATED Wind Advisory: MTA Bridges and Tunnels to Prohibit Certain Trucks from Crossings Beginning Monday, March 16

Bridges and Tunnels
Updated Mar 15, 2026 12:30 p.m.

Ban in Place 4:00 p.m. Monday Through 12:00 a.m. Tuesday

 

Check MTA App or mta.info for Latest Service Updates

 

MTA Bridges and Tunnels today announced that due to forecasts of high wind conditions, the agency will be implementing a ban on empty tractor-trailers and tandem (piggyback, dual, triple, etc.) trucks at all of our bridges beginning at 4:00 p.m. on Monday, March 16, 2026.

 

Based on the current forecast and the timing of this weather event, it is anticipated that the ban will remain in effect until approximately 12:00 a.m. on Tuesday, March 17, 2026. However, the operational period for this restriction will be adjusted as necessary based on current conditions and updated forecasts.

 

The seven bridges where the prohibition will be in effect are:

 

  • Bronx-Whitestone Bridge

  • Cross Bay Bridge

  • Henry Hudson Bridge

  • Marine Parkway Bridge

  • Robert F. Kennedy Bridge

  • Throgs Neck Bridge

  • Verrazzano-Narrows Bridge
